Question 3: What kind of media institution might distribute your media product and why?
Our film, in two minds has a production company - Candi Studios, and a distribution company which we have chosen is Revolver entertainment
They have produced and distributed many successful british films such as Revolver Entertainment is a marketing-lead, all rights film distribution company. Founded in 1997, the company has operations in both London and Los Angeles.
In the video I have put together, it demonstrates why we have chosen a small independent company to distribute our movie. As our we had a very low budget, we improvised mostly by choosing an appropriate location where it will depict a strong meaning through the mise en scene.

Risk assessment
Potential Risks
- As we are filming outside there are risks that we could either trip or fall over which could lead to to hurting ourselves or damaging expensive equipment
- Another potential hazzard of filming outside is that the weatcher could cause injury and damage equipment.
- As our props consist of a lighter, knife and cigarette there are many serious injuries that could take place. In order to prevent any damage we will handle with care and act responsibly around people if it is in our possession.
- We will also make sure that someone is with the equipment at all time, we will treat it with the utmost respect as we do not want to loose any work and have to pay for lost equipment.
